> IPVS 1.0.7 has fixes related to large packets, now LVS
> should not send packets with bad csum in such case.
>
> Jacob, can you test with 1.0.7?

I just tried with 1.0.7; still doesn't work.

Anything you guys need me to run, log, etc, just let me know and I'll be
happy to.

In the meantime, I've taken the load balancing back out on the production
site.  I have left a second load balanced website running for future
testing.

If I can't find a solution, I'll try using one of the other methods.  I'm
more than happy to help the developers if you want to find the root of the
problem.

One final thing: it appears that the fragmented packets never make it back
to the realserver.  I'm showing about 3 pages worth of tcp and icmp packets
going to the director, but only one tcp and one icmp making it to the
realserver.
